Abstract

The embodiment of the specification provides a method for maintaining a system, by providing a plurality of visual interfaces of parameter components which can be edited, a user can operate the parameter components, so that a first parameter component receiving the operation can generate a first parameter, and the first parameter can be directly sent to a service system associated with the first parameter component in a plurality of service systems because the parameter components and the service system establish a data transmission association channel, so that the service system is configured based on the first parameter, and maintenance of a plurality of service systems can be completed only by operating the visual interfaces, thereby simplifying the maintenance process.

Description

Method and device for maintaining system and electronic equipment
Technical Field
The present disclosure relates to the field of computers, and in particular, to a method, an apparatus, and an electronic device for maintaining a system.
Background
The service system needs maintenance and configuration parameters, and the original data in the database is often referred to when the service system is maintained, however, the original data is unprocessed or possibly incomplete, so that the existing service system configuration mode still needs manual configuration.
In the case of complex service scenarios, the development of service systems needs to embody service delivery scenarios, so that the industry often generates the development of different service systems to meet delivery requirements in different scenarios, and because of the difference in parameter sets required by different service systems, the parameter maintenance of the service systems is usually also performed separately for each service system.
Such maintenance systems are cumbersome and a need exists for a simplified method of maintaining the system.

Fig. 1 is a schematic diagram of a method for maintaining a system according to an embodiment of the present disclosure, where the method may include:
s101, providing a visual interface for maintaining system parameters, wherein the visual interface comprises a plurality of parameter components which can be edited, and the parameter components establish data transmission association channels with a plurality of business systems.
First, the method may further include:
a plurality of service systems are constructed based on various scene requirements in the service flow, and the parameter sets required when different service systems are configured are different.
In one embodiment, the plurality of business systems may be: data platform type systems, marketing business systems, reporting business systems, etc., are not specifically described herein.
After having multiple business systems, we can configure a visual interface with multiple parameter components for it and establish data transmission association channels for the parameter components with the multiple business systems.
The data transmission association channel can be established by configuring a data synchronization component for a data table of the parameter component and a data table of the service platform, or by configuring a query interface for the parameter component, which is not described in detail herein.
When the parameter component and a plurality of service systems are established to form a data transmission association channel, association information showing association relation needs to be determined, and the method can further comprise the following steps:
and acquiring association information and associating the parameter component with the service system based on the association information, wherein the association information has an association relationship between the parameter component and the service system.
In one embodiment, the acquiring the association information may include:
and providing a visual interface with an association operation component, and acquiring association information generated by association operation of a user.
In an application scenario, a user may associate through clicking, for example, clicking a parameter component a and clicking an icon "associate", clicking a service system 1 and a service system 2, and then the background may automatically obtain an association relationship: the parameter component A is associated with the service system 1 and the service system 2, and a data transmission associated channel is established based on the parameter component A.
In another embodiment, the acquiring the association information may include:
and acquiring an association request of a service system, wherein the association request carries the service system sending the association request and parameter assembly information associated with the service system request.
This may mean that the business system requests from the background of the visualization interface with which parameter component a data transmission association channel is established.
S102: and receiving operation of a user in a first parameter component of the visual interface to generate a first parameter, and sending the first parameter to a service system associated with the first parameter component in a plurality of service systems.
In an embodiment of the present disclosure, the sending the first parameter to a service system associated with the first parameter component among the service systems may include:
executing a data synchronization rule and sending the first parameter to an associated service system through the data transmission association channel.
Specifically, a data synchronization rule may be configured for a plurality of parameter components in the visual interface in advance, and after the first parameter component generates a first parameter, the data synchronization rule is executed and the first parameter is synchronized to a data table or a database of the service system according to the association relationship.
In an embodiment of the present disclosure, the sending the first parameter to a service system associated with the first parameter component in the service systems may also include:
and responding to a call request of a service system, determining a parameter component associated with the service system, inquiring a first parameter generated by the parameter component, and sending the first parameter to the service system.
In order to realize the call, a call function can be preconfigured for each service system, and when the service system needs to be maintained, the first parameter is automatically called by utilizing the preconfigured call function.
In an embodiment of the present disclosure, the first parameter includes a channel identifier and a flow parameter of the channel.
In this embodiment of the present specification, the channels include a main channel of a business process dimension and a third party sub-channel implementing the business process.
Wherein, the main channel of business process dimension can be the channel of inviting friends and the resource allocation channel,
these business needs ultimately need to be fulfilled through third party sub-channels, such as short messages, friend circles, etc.
In this embodiment of the present disclosure, when a user inputs a parameter, the user may input different channel numbers and channel number parameters to different parameter components, or may segment channel information under the same channel number and input the channel information to different parameter components, so that different service systems may configure parameters of different channel numbers, or may configure parameters of different fields of the same channel number, and fields of the parameters may be determined according to attributes of the parameters, and therefore, the multiple components in the visual interface may also be divided according to attributes of the parameters, which is not described in detail herein.
S103: the business system receives the first parameter and configures the first parameter based on the first parameter.
By providing a plurality of visual interfaces for editing parameter components, a user can operate the parameter components, so that the first parameter component receiving the operation can generate a first parameter, and the first parameter can be directly sent to a service system associated with the first parameter component in a plurality of service systems because the parameter components and the service system establish a data transmission association channel, so that the service system is configured based on the first parameter, and maintenance of the service systems can be completed by only operating the visual interfaces, thereby simplifying the maintenance process.
In an application scenario, when maintaining an association relationship, a user can associate parameter sets with corresponding service systems through association operation, so that a data transmission association channel is established between each parameter assembly and the corresponding service system; when the parameters are configured, a user can open and access the visual interface, the visual interface displays parameter components for inputting different parameters, the user only needs to concentrate on the visual interface to input the parameters, the system can automatically perform maintenance, and the user is not required to open a plurality of maintenance pages, so that the maintenance process is simplified.
